Manufacturer Part Number Production Description 0 1 2 3 4 5 6 7 8 9 A B C D E F Output Datasheet
Template 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?
RCA CD4026B Active (TI) BCD Counter, Up 0 1 2 3 4 5 6 7 8 9 Active-High [1]
RCA CD4033B Active (TI) BCD Counter, Up 0 1 2 3 4 5 6 7 8 9 Active-High [1]
RCA CD40110B Active (TI) BCD Counter, Up/Down 0 1 2 3 4 5 6 7 8 9 Active-High [2]
RCA CD4511B Active (TI) BCD Decoder, Latch 0 1 2 3 4 5 6 7 8 9 sp sp sp sp sp sp Active-High [3]
RCA CD4543B Active (TI) BCD Decoder, Latch 0 1 2 3 4 5 6 7 8 9 sp sp sp sp sp sp Active-High or Low [4]
Motorola MC14495-1 Discontinued Hex Decoder, Latch 0 1 2 3 4 5 6 7 8 9 A b C d E F Active-High, 290Ω [5]
Motorola MC14558B Discontinued BCD Decoder 0 1* 2 3 4 5 6 7 8 9 sp sp sp sp sp sp Active-High [6]
TI SN74LS47 Active BCD Decoder 0 1 2 3 4 5 6 7 8 9 c a v* D t sp Active-Low [7]
TI SN74LS247 Active BCD Decoder 0 1 2 3 4 5 6 7 8 9 c a v* D t sp Active-Low [8]
Table notes
  • For the "0" to "F" columns,
  • each 4-bit input is shown as its 7-segment decoded output.
  • For the "Output" column,
  • Active-High means a high occurs when a segment is on, where as Active-Low means a low occurs when a segment is on.
  • PP means Push-Pull output driver, OC means Open-Collector output driver, OE means Open-Emitter output driver, CC means Constant Current output driver.
